Feminist Therapy therapists in Concord, New Hampshire Statistics

Feminist Therapy therapists in Concord, New Hampshire average 14 years of experience and charge around $216 per session. 100% offer online sessions. The most commonly treated issues are Anxiety or Fears (78%), Stress (59%), and Depression (57%).
